Player Unknown Battlegrounds update 5.2 now live on PC

November 21, 2019 by Andrew Newton

PUBG Corporation has announced that Update 5.2 for the PC version of Player Unknown Battlegrounds is now live and brings with it some new changes and additions to make Season 5 a season never to forget.  Check out the update video below for more details.

A new piece of equipment is available for players to stop any opponent trying to run them down in a vehicle.  The Spike Trap (or Stinger as UK police call it) is a long strip of spikes designed to stop a single vehicle in its tracks by puncturing the tyres.  Spike Traps will spawn randomly across all maps and are single use only items that can be used to stop a pursuing vehicle, once deployed they cannot be picked up again even if the pursuing car managed to avoid them.  A car hitting these spikes will only have their tyres punctured, it will not do any damage to the vehicle itself.

The update will also affect the snowy slopes of Vikendi with changes being made to make the map more appealing to snipers.  There’s also been the following changes and additions:

  • Addition of new roads to help travel the map’s snowy wastes.
  • Amount of vehicles available increased.
  • The river around Castle has frozen.
  • Decreased height of Mount Kreznic.
  • Town of Volnova has been reshaped.
  • Town of Peshkova sees an increase in item spawn counts.
  • Vehicle spawing garages in Trevno have been relocated.

The tacticians among you will also be able to plan a course using the new Map Waypoint system.  When the map is open players can place up to four waypoints for their team to follow.
